+// PowerPC supports VLAs.
+// RUN: %clang_cc1 -verify -fopenmp -x c++ -triple powerpc64le-unknown-unknown -fopenmp-targets=powerpc64le-unknown-unknown -emit-llvm-bc %s -o %t-ppc-host-ppc.bc
+// RUN: %clang_cc1 -verify -fopenmp -x c++ -triple powerpc64le-unknown-unknown -fopenmp-targets=powerpc64le-unknown-unknown -emit-llvm %s -fopenmp-is-device -fopenmp-host-ir-file-path %t-ppc-host-ppc.bc -o %t-ppc-device.ll
+
+// Nvidia GPUs don't support VLAs.
+// RUN: %clang_cc1 -verify -fopenmp -x c++ -triple powerpc64le-unknown-unknown -fopenmp-targets=nvptx64-nvidia-cuda -emit-llvm-bc %s -o %t-ppc-host-nvptx.bc
+// RUN: %clang_cc1 -verify -DNO_VLA -fopenmp -x c++ -triple nvptx64-unknown-unknown -fopenmp-targets=nvptx64-nvidia-cuda -emit-llvm %s -fopenmp-is-device -fopenmp-host-ir-file-path %t-ppc-host-nvptx.bc -o %t-nvptx-device.ll
+
+#ifndef NO_VLA
+// expected-no-diagnostics
+#endif
+
+#pragma omp declare target
+void declare(int arg) {
+ int a[2];
+#ifdef NO_VLA
+ // expected-error@+2 {{variable length arrays are not supported for the current target}}
+#endif
+ int vla[arg];
+}
+
+void declare_parallel_reduction(int arg) {
+ int a[2];
+
+#pragma omp parallel reduction(+: a)
+ { }
+
+#pragma omp parallel reduction(+: a[0:2])
+ { }
+
+#ifdef NO_VLA
+ // expected-error@+3 {{cannot generate code for reduction on array section, which requires a variable length array}}
+ // expected-note@+2 {{variable length arrays are not supported for the current target}}
+#endif
+#pragma omp parallel reduction(+: a[0:arg])
+ { }
+}
+#pragma omp end declare target
+
+template <typename T>
+void target_template(int arg) {
+#pragma omp target
+ {
+#ifdef NO_VLA
+ // expected-error@+2 {{variable length arrays are not supported for the current target}}
+#endif
+ T vla[arg];
+ }
+}
+
+void target(int arg) {
+#pragma omp target
+ {
+#ifdef NO_VLA
+ // expected-error@+2 {{variable length arrays are not supported for the current target}}
+#endif
+ int vla[arg];
+ }
+
+#pragma omp target
+ {
+#pragma omp parallel
+ {
+#ifdef NO_VLA
+ // expected-error@+2 {{variable length arrays are not supported for the current target}}
+#endif
+ int vla[arg];
+ }
+ }
+
+ target_template<long>(arg);
+}
